Who Was Mao Zedong Anyway?

Before we get into the nitty-gritty of the Mao Zedong hairstyle, let’s take a quick look at the man behind the hair. Mao Zedong was more than just a leader; he was a revolutionary thinker, a poet, and a key figure in shaping modern China. His influence on Chinese politics and culture cannot be overstated.

Born on December 26, 1893, in Shaoshan, Hunan Province, Mao rose from humble beginnings to become one of the most powerful leaders in history. His journey wasn’t easy, but his determination and vision helped him rise to prominence. By the time he became the Chairman of the People’s Republic of China in 1949, Mao had already carved out a legacy that would last for generations.
